Job Description

Role Overview:

We are seeking a highly motivated and analytical individual to join our global Cyber Threat Intelligence team as a Cyber Threat Intelligence Sr. Analyst. As a part of our Advisory & Assessment team, you will contribute to the identification and mitigation of emerging threats, enabling our clients to proactively defend against cyberattacks.

Responsibilities:

Evaluation of Created Searches:

- Assess the effectiveness of the created searches in detecting relevant Indicators of Compromise (IOCs) and Tactics, Techniques, and Procedures (TTPs).

- Analyze the frequency of false positives and false negatives to refine search criteria and minimize errors.

Reviewing Reports:

- Examine the clarity, completeness of the manual and automated reports.

- Validate the accuracy of the information presented in the reports, including TTPs, and any associated threat intelligence.

Quality Assurance of Incident Analysis:

- Evaluate the thoroughness and depth of incident analysis conducted by Analysts/Associates in response to detected TRI events. Including mentioned mitigations or containment actions in the incidents by analysts.

- Verify adherence to established incident response procedures and protocols.

Requirements:

- Educational Background: Bachelor's degree in Cybersecurity,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field.

- Knowledge and Interest: Passion for cybersecurity and a good understanding of the threat landscape, emerging trends, threat actors, and attack vectors. Awareness of different industry and regional threats is advantageous

- Analytical Skills: Excellent analytical and critical thinking abilities to interpret complex data, identify patterns, and extract meaningful insights.

- Communication Skills: Effective written and verbal communication skills to present technical information clearly and concisely, both internally and externally.

- Detail-oriented: Strong attention to detail, ensuring accuracy and precision in research, analysis, and reporting.

- Collaboration: Ability to work effectively in a team environment, collaborating with colleagues and customers to achieve common objectives.

- Continuous Learning: Eagerness to stay updated on the latest cybersecurity trends, threat intelligence methodologies, and tools.

Certifications: CTIA, CPTIA, GCTI, Cyber Threat Intelligence Training (arcX), CompTIA CySA+ certifications would be advantageous.

- Should have strong knowledge of MITRE framework.

- Minimum 3 years of experience in cyber security(SOC or Threat Intelligence)
